Property transfer after death

Sir / madam,

 My Late father had a Registered agriculture piece of land on his name. He expired 9 years back and did not write any will.Know we (me and my 2 married sister's) want that this property registration title to be transferred into the name of my mother / or we can sell it off.What are the formalities that are required to be completed for transfer of property title and property sell off . Both of my sisters live abroad and it is very rare that both of them visit india at the same time. Is there simultaneous physical presence necessary in this entire process.

Adv.R.P.Chugh (Advocate/Legal Consultant (rpchughadvocatesupremecourt@hotmail.com))     25 June 2012

They don't need to come they can execute a POA notarised by Indian Consul in their country, authorising you to execute and get registered the land deeds on their behalf, this POA should be registered in India at place where property is situated after which you can sell off or transfer the properties. 

S Jadhav 98336 98330 (Jadhav & Associates)     25 June 2012

Rajneeshji,

Please approach the local authorities to get the title transferred in your name by providing the relevant documents such as the death certificate, the release deeds by other heirs, etc.

For getting the release deeds from your sisters, they do not have to come to India to register the Power of Attorney (PoA). They can do so in the country that they are in at the Consul General's office and at different times also. Both of them do not have to be together. But do not forget to get the PoA registered at the local registrar where the property is located.

You can sell off the property without getting it transferred in your name, so if you are selling it off you may consider not getting it transferred in your name (this may also help you in saving taxes).

Ajit Singh Cheema (practising Advocate)     25 June 2012

Get the inheritance mutation in favour of your mother , by putting in / up Relinquishment deed / power of attorney  duly signed and attested from yourself and your sisters . Physical presence of the sisters can be avoided by necessary attestation by counsulate general office.
